Ruth's Chris Steakhouse Uniform: Style, Quality, and Professional Look

The Ruth Chris uniform sets the standard for upscale steakhouse professionalism and guest experience. This ensemble combines tailored fit, premium materials, and clear brand identity to support staff confidence and table service excellence.

Consistent appearance across teams reinforces trust, safety, and operational flow from hostess to server to busser. The following sections explore styling details, performance expectations, and real world scenarios that define the modern Ruth Chris uniform.

Role Key Garment Color & Branding Function
Host Double breasted jacket, tailored trousers Black jacket, subtle logo First impression, seating coordination
Server Single breasted jacket, performance shirt Navy or black with trim stripes Mobility, spill resistance, visible name badge
Busser Short sleeve shirt, dark trousers Standard hue, embroidered logo Speed, clear team role
Manager Full suit or elevated separates Refined palette, distinguished trim Leadership presence, client meetings
